New York 87, Toronto 80

TORONTO, April 30 (UPI) -- Another clutch three-point shot by Larry Johnson and
another fade down the stretch by Toronto Sunday sent the New York Knicks into
the Eastern Conference semifinals Sunday with an 87-80 victory over the Raptors.

New York swept the Raptors in three games, finishing things off in the first NBA
playoff game ever played outside the United States.

Johnson hit a pair of free throws and banked in athree-pointer as the Knicks
closed the game with a 9-2 run.

The Knicks, who had lost three of four regular-season games against Toronto,
will meet bitter rival Miami in the conference semifinals beginning next Sunday
